View More InsightsSmart fabrics and knitwear are creating new opportunities and markets for apparel knitting mills manufacturers as it presents new product opportunities and promotes innovations in the industry. Smart textiles also called electronic textiles, e-textiles, smart garments, and fabrics, have digital components embedded in them. Smart textiles are products that use technology for fashion and design purposes adding a multisensorial experience, through lighting, sounds. The size of the global smart fabrics market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 30.4% by 2025.
Covid-19 has created immense challenges for many industries and apparel knitting manufacturers were not spared. Supply chain disruptions affected the shipment of products, leading to declining sales of knitwear. Additionally, restrictions and lockdowns negatively affected production making it hard to meet the increased online demand leading to many areas of the industry facing various obstacles.
